What Does Having Legal Aid Mean in Nicholson?

Legal aid in Nicholson is an essential service that is pivotal in ensuring access to justice for individuals who might otherwise be unable to afford legal representation and advice. It serves as a cornerstone in upholding the principle that everyone, irrespective of their financial means, should have access to legal assistance and protections. This article explores the concept of legal aid, its value, the various types it takes, and the issues it encounters.

Understanding Legal Aid

Legal help in Nicholson refers to services offered to assist individuals in navigating the legal system, including legal defense, legal advice, and insight. These services are typically made available to people with low incomes who cannot afford private attorneys.

Importance of Legal Aid in Nicholson

Access to Justice: Legal assistance closes the gap between individuals who can pay for legal services and those who cannot. Without legal assistance, many individuals would be left to handle legal problems by themselves, potentially causing inequitable results. Legal aid ensures that the legal system is fair and equitable for all.

Protection of Rights:

Legal assistance is vital in protecting the rights of individuals. For instance, in criminal cases, access to legal defense is critical to guaranteeing a fair trial for the accused. In civil cases, legal assistance can help people settle conflicts, obtain housing, and get needed benefits.

Societal Benefits:

By offering legal aid to the needy, legal aid services enhance societal stability. When people can settle their legal problems, they are better able to focus on other aspects of their lives, such as work and family. This, in turn, fosters stronger, more stable communities.

Forms of Legal Aid

Legal aid can take various forms, depending on the type of legal problem and the available resources. Some of the typical forms include:

Court Representation:

This involves providing an attorney to defend a person in court. This is especially crucial in criminal cases, where the outcome can greatly affect a person’s life and liberty.

Legal Advice and Counseling:

Many legal aid organizations provide advice and counseling to aid individuals in grasping their legal rights and alternatives. This can include assistance with creating legal documents or giving advice on how to move forward with a legal issue.

Pro Bono Legal Assistance:

Volunteer legal services are offered by private attorneys who offer their time to provide free legal assistance to people who need it. Many law firms and individual attorneys accept pro bono cases as part of their professional commitment to public service.

Community Legal Clinics:

Legal clinics are often administered by law schools or non-profit groups and offer free or affordable legal services to the community. These clinics may focus on specific areas of law, such as family-related legal matters or immigration.

Web-Based Resources:

With the rise of technology, many legal support groups now provide digital resources, including legal data, self-help guides, and online consultations. These resources can be particularly beneficial for individuals who do not have convenient access to physical legal aid offices.

Issues Confronting Legal Aid

Even though it is vital, legal support services encounter various obstacles:

Supply and Demand Imbalance:

The requirement for legal aid often surpasses the supply. This means that many individuals who need legal assistance may not be able to receive it in a timely manner, or not at all. This discrepancy can lead to overworked legal aid lawyers and clients experiencing longer waits.

Understanding:

There is often a lack of awareness about the accessibility of legal aid services. A lot of individuals who could benefit from legal aid may not realize that these services are provided or how to get them. Increasing public awareness is key to making sure more individuals use these resources.

Geographical Inequities:

Availability of legal aid can vary significantly depending on geographic location. Rural regions, specifically, may have a shortage of legal aid resources compared to urban centers, creating disparities in access to justice.

In Conclusion

Legal aid is a critical element of a just and fair legal system. By giving legal assistance to individuals who can’t pay for it, legal aid guarantees that fairness and justice are maintained.
